Wrong thinking produces wrong emotions, wrong reactions, wrong behavior - and unhappiness! Learning to deal with your thoughts is the first step on the road to healthy thinking. How to handle one's thoughts properly is what this book is all about! It explains the life-changing method the authors call misbelief therapy, and it can work for you.
